Broker Execution and Fee Transparency: The Real Comparison
A rebate may look attractive on paper, but execution quality and fee transparency determine whether you keep more of your profits. Compare spreads at different market conditions, review commission schedules, and confirm how swaps or overnight charges work. Service comparison should include trade execution speed Crypto Trading Brokers expectations, order types offered, and how the broker handles requotes or partial fills. The best setups pair competitive costs with rebates that are easy to quantify, so your effective cost per trade becomes the benchmark you can manage.
When assessing partner programs, verify whether rebates apply to both standard and commission-based models, and whether the rebate rate changes by volume tiers. If the terms differ by account or instrument, record those differences and match them to your strategy style—scalping, swing trading, or long-term positioning.
Account Compatibility and Support for Rebates
Service comparison should focus on practical account compatibility. Check which platforms are supported, whether you can use hedging or netting accounts, and if the broker offers reliable deposit and withdrawal rails that fit your preferences. Rebate programs often rely on unique tracking links or partner IDs, so ensure setup is straightforward and that you can confirm attribution before placing meaningful trade volume. Review the broker’s support responsiveness, especially if you anticipate questions about rebate calculations, missing credits, or instrument eligibility.
